My 10 Favorite Things to Eat Near Work (Gramercy)

Mikes.jpgI say I live in Sunset Park, but really, I live at my office in Gramercy.  So here are my 10 favorite things to eat when I’m at my place of residence (in no particular order.)

  1. Mike’s Coffee & Deli — a tiny hole in the wall for my breakfast.  These guys are consummate New York professionals — three guys in a tiny 8×12 space keeping track of 5, 6, 7 finicky New Yorker sandwich orders at any given moment.  Plus, it’s cheaper than any of the other places by about half ($1.50 for my egg and cheese on a roll).
  2. Tiffin Wallah — lunch buffet for $7.60, my fave dishes are the palak paneer and the okra tomato.  I prefer the little pancakes to the chapati.  I refrain from seconds because that can render me completely useless in the afternoon.  When pressed for time, consider dropping in for lunch — you’d be surprised at how quickly you can be in and out of there, especially if you’re alone.
  3. BCD Tofu – Soon du bu with pork, regular spicy.  Their rice is always perfect.  Love the fried mackerel you always get for free as a starter, and the oyster in the slightly sweet kimchi adds just the right amount of brine.
  4. Chipotle — chicken burrito bowl, rice, black beans, tomato salsa, lettuce.  Go ahead, judge me.
  5. Wichcraft — olive oil poached shrimp salad over mixed greens instead of arugula.  I often need to supplement with a hard boiled egg.
  6. Maoz vegetarian — Forget the falafel — their fried eggplant is a marvel of shard and goo.  That and the salty fried cauliflower from the toppings bar and I am in heaven.
  7. Mandoo Bar — kimchi & tofu dumplings with pork.  Boiled.  Though it never feels like a full meal to just eat dumplings.
  8. E-Mo — kimbap, usually with spicy tuna and sesame leaf, to eat on the subway.  With my hands.  Yes, I’m that person, and stop looking at me.
  9. Stumptown — Soy cappuccino.  It really is the best coffee.  I wouldn’t normally trust a place so overrun with hipsters, but the coffee is unfailingly a cut above.  The espresso drinks are pretty nicely priced.
  10. Kalustyan’s — California dried apricots with the right balance of tart and sweet; high turnover means they’re always moist. 

Bonus:
Best place for office birthday treats: Penelope for cupcakes or Wichcraft for cookies.  We especially like the oatmeal with cream cheese frosting cookie sandwich.

Place I never eat, even though it’s super close:
Artisanal
— I went there once for dinner, didn’t like it much, and seems dangerous to eat too much cheese for lunch.
